What is Warsaw Wireless?
Warsaw Wireless operates as a dedicated mobile phone shop and a retailer for Boost Mobile, offering a comprehensive selection of mobile devices, essential accessories, and protective gear. Their product catalog features leading brands such as Apple, Samsung, Motorola, and Celero, complemented by a range of audio devices, chargers, and wearable technology. The company primarily serves customers in the Warsaw area seeking mobile phones, accessories, and related services, often enhancing the customer experience through targeted promotional offers and bundled packages.
